Months ago I've been talking about getting a jazz-like kit, something totally different to my double bass setup, and finally, I can introduce it to you.
Enjoy the pics! I know Ali already did
EDIT: Ooops! I forgot the specs!
MC Custom Drums, Guatambú shells in zebrawood finish (I need help here; I asked for Makassar ebony but I'm sure it isn't that finish), 12x8, 14x14, 18x16, Sabian HH Manhattan ride 22" and HHX Groove hats 14" (I'll be adding an Istambul not so soon..), and borrowed hardware from the other kit (still need a bass pedal and snare stand)
